主頁 > 網(wǎng)站建設(shè) > 建站知識(shí) > DedeCMS用SQL快速批量刪除關(guān)鍵字TAG標(biāo)簽

DedeCMS用SQL快速批量刪除關(guān)鍵字TAG標(biāo)簽

POST TIME:2017-11-12 23:44

dedecms怎樣批量刪除TAG標(biāo)簽?zāi)兀?/h3>

在dedecms的后臺(tái)的核心—批量維護(hù)—TAG標(biāo)簽管理里我們可以刪除TAG標(biāo)簽,但是這樣如果我們的TAG標(biāo)簽很多的時(shí)候,這樣操作會(huì)很累。

批量的刪除TAG標(biāo)簽

登錄數(shù)據(jù)庫,或在dedecms后臺(tái)->系統(tǒng) -> SQL命令行工具,復(fù)制語句:

Delete FROM dede_tagindex where typeid not in (SELECT id FROM dede_arctype);
Delete FROM dede_taglist where typeid not in (SELECT id FROM dede_arctype);

以上的sql語句可以把整個(gè)網(wǎng)站的TAG標(biāo)簽刪除掉,大家請(qǐng)謹(jǐn)慎使用。

執(zhí)行完以后,我們?cè)僭诤笈_(tái)更新下緩存。再去看下后臺(tái)的TAG標(biāo)簽管理中的TAG標(biāo)簽是不是全部被刪除了。

如果批量刪除TAG標(biāo)簽后更新還是反復(fù)出現(xiàn)

這個(gè)情況還是困擾了許多站長(zhǎng),其實(shí)是因?yàn)榫W(wǎng)站有內(nèi)容回收站的功能,里面的文章并沒有被直接刪除,而是被標(biāo)記了而已,跟計(jì)算機(jī)的回收站功能是一樣的,還可以對(duì)誤刪除的文章恢復(fù)處理,建議保留網(wǎng)站的內(nèi)容回收站功能。

如果反復(fù)出現(xiàn)這個(gè)已經(jīng)被刪除了的標(biāo)簽,可以到內(nèi)容回收站找到帶這個(gè)TAG標(biāo)簽的文章,刪除該文章即可。

首頁、列表頁重復(fù)出現(xiàn)TAG標(biāo)簽,文章頁正常

這種情況是最好到用Navicat或者phpMyAdmin打開數(shù)據(jù)庫,刪除表dede_taglist下的所有信息,按照下面方法重新獲取關(guān)鍵字和TAG標(biāo)簽

重新獲取關(guān)鍵字、TAG標(biāo)簽

TAG標(biāo)簽實(shí)際上是文章的關(guān)鍵詞,最好把自動(dòng)獲取文章的關(guān)鍵詞功能關(guān)閉,找到:系統(tǒng) -> 系統(tǒng)基本參數(shù) -> 其他選項(xiàng) -> 自動(dòng)獲取關(guān)鍵字。

把全站的關(guān)鍵詞全刪除,執(zhí)行SQL命令:

Delete from dede_search_cache;
Delete from dede_search_keywords;
Delete from dede_keywords;

重新獲取關(guān)鍵字,再重新獲取TAG標(biāo)簽,找到常用 -> 批量維護(hù) -> 文檔關(guān)鍵詞維護(hù)和TAG標(biāo)簽管理




上一篇:DedeCMS首頁將縮略圖做為樣式背景圖

下一篇:織夢(mèng)選擇副欄目突破9個(gè)限制的方法

收縮
  • 微信客服
  • 微信二維碼
  • 電話咨詢

  • 400-1100-266